AI Contract Overview
The contract seeks multiple awards for the supply of perishable subsistence items to the United States Penitentiary Lewisburg in Pennsylvania, with deliveries scheduled for the week of October 11-15, 2010. This procurement is handled as a total small business set-aside under NAICS code 424410 and follows a pre-solicitation process where proposals are requested without a formal written solicitation. Awards will be made on a per line item basis to responsible offerors whose quotes are compliant and deemed most advantageous to the government, with evaluations focusing on price and past performance. No substitutions of items are permitted, and the solicitation will be accessible only through the Federal Business Opportunities website around September 1, 2010, with quotes due by approximately September 14, 2010. Deliveries are to be made directly to USP Lewisburg, with specific delivery dates potentially varying by line item. The contracting agency, part of the Department of Justice at FCI Lewisburg, provides contact points for inventory and contract management to assist interested vendors. Faith-Based and Community-Based Organizations are encouraged to participate equally, reflecting the inclusive nature of this 100% small business set-aside. Vendors are responsible for monitoring the designated website to ensure they have the latest information regarding this acquisition.
